Hi everyone. I'm visiting Moscow for a couple of weeks this September.

I'm very interested in seeing Red Square. And since Red Square has been used for many big outdoor concerts by world-famous artists, I started wondering about one thing.

Which outdoor stadiums in Moscow are used for large-scale concerts?

I think Madonna performed at Luzhniki Stadium a few years back. And I think Michael Jackson performed at Dinamo Stadium a long, long time ago.

I know that Moscow has Olimpiisky, but that's indoors.

Is Red Square still being used for concerts? How about Luzhniki Stadium and Dinamo Stadium? How about the smaller Lokomotiv Stadium?

Will the new Spartak Stadium be used as a concert venue?

Yes, Luzhniki and Olimpiisky are the common ones. Not sure about Dinamo. I can't recall any major concerts in Red Square recently. About 2.5 years ago Eric Clapton was supposed to play there but the authorities withdrew the permit and the show was cancelled...
